    Dennis X.

    tldr; aesthetics and taste are top notch! I came with my mom and a friend on a Thursday evening and the restaurant was pretty much empty. I get it, this is def a brunch place, but we still wanted to try it out. The restaurant has an outdoor patio if you're feeling outdoor vibes. The interior design of the restaurant is really cute, bright, and very floral. I really liked it! After you order, your dishes do come with a complimentary Fidel Soup and Toast. My mom and I absolutely enjoyed it! The menu does have a lot of options: both all-day breakfast and other options. My group ordered the Salmon, the Omelette, and the Chicken Wrap. We all really enjoyed our food and finished all of it. My wrap was fresh and light, and the sauce it came with tied everything really well together. I also ordered a Mimosa (of course, I had to!). There are a few fruity options to choose from. I ended up getting the Strawberry mimosa and loved it. My mom ordered a Macchiato; it looked really good and she has come multiple times to this restaurant just to order it! Galilea was our server and she is such an angel! I definitely recommend coming in if you're craving for a mimosa brunch and some very aesthetically pleasing photo ops!

    Mari P.

    Birthday brunch for my cousin was excellent, starting with being greeted as we walked in. We ordered chicken albondigas (meatball soup) and enchiladas entomatadas (red spicy sauce) with carnitas. One word.....DELICIOUS! The meal started with a cup of Fideo soup, which is included in all meals. Per my cousin, the albondigas were very, very good. The enchiladas with the carnitas was absolutely delicious, not to mention the strawberry mimosa. Mimosas can be ordered with several different flavors. Our server, Lucy, is the best, very friendly, attentive, and was very efficient. She also acknowledged my cousin's birthday with a song and cheesecake! I highly recommend this restaurant..... I wish I would have taken pictures of the food, but once we received it, all thoughts went out the window except for eating the delicious meal!
